The world has seen tremendous progress in the capabilities of robots in the past year. Robots can now walk, dance, run and perform increasingly sophisticated movements, yet impressive demonstrations do not equal commercial value. Beyond the hype surrounding China’s red-hot embodied robotics sector, one challenge confronts all players: data. Robotics has long faced the challenge of achieving widespread adoption.
